Acute Effects of Hot-pack Therapy on Lumbar Erector Spinae Muscle Stiffness and Pain in Adults With Low Back Pain: A Randomised Controlled Trial.

简要总结

This single-centre, parallel-group randomized controlled trial will test whether one session of moist hot-pack therapy produces immediate improvements in pain intensity and lumbar erector spinae muscle stiffness in adults with nonspecific low back pain. Participants are randomized 1:1 to hot-pack or sham (room-temperature pack). Outcomes are assessed at baseline and immediately after the session using VAS (0-10 cm) and MyotonPro; a short follow-up (24-48 h) captures Oswestry Disability Index (ODI) and perceived change. The intervention is brief, low-risk, and commonly used in clinical practice, yet high-quality evidence on its acute effects is limited.

详细描述

Rationale. Hot-pack (thermotherapy) is frequently prescribed to reduce pain and muscle tension in low back pain, but controlled evidence quantifying immediate changes in muscle mechanical properties and pain remains scarce. Demonstrating short-term benefits with objective measures (MyotonPro) and validated scales (VAS, ODI) could inform pragmatic care pathways for nonspecific low back pain.

Objectives and Hypotheses. Primary objective: determine whether a single hot-pack session reduces erector spinae stiffness (MyotonPro) and pain (VAS) versus sham. Secondary objective: explore short-term effects on functional disability (ODI) and perceived improvement. We hypothesize greater immediate reductions in stiffness and pain, and better short-term function, with hot-pack versus sham.

Design and Setting. Prospective, two-arm, parallel RCT at Atatürk University Faculty of Medicine (Physical Medicine & Rehabilitation / Orthopedics). Target sample: 30 adults (pilot). Allocation is 1:1 using computer-generated randomization; outcome assessors and participants are blinded.

Participants. Adults 18-65 y with nonspecific/mechanical low back pain and baseline VAS ≥ 3/10. Key exclusions include pregnancy, pacemaker/implanted devices, recent lumbar surgery or heat/cold therapy (<6 weeks), dermatologic lesions, neurologic deficit, tumour, or systemic inflammatory disease. Written informed consent is obtained before any procedure.

盲法说明

Participants receive either a heated moist pack or an identical setup with a room-temperature pack; identical towel barriers and procedures maintain participant blinding. The treating therapist cannot be blinded due to the nature of heat delivery. Outcome assessors are blinded to allocation; data are recorded with coded IDs to preserve blinding during analysis

入选标准

  • Adults aged 18-65 years
  • Nonspecific/mechanical low back pain (clinical diagnosis)
  • Baseline pain ≥3/10 on a 0-10 Visual Analogue Scale (VAS)
  • Able to understand procedures and provide written informed consent
  • Able to attend baseline, immediate post-session, and 24-48 h follow-up assessments

排除标准

  • Neurologic deficit, tumour, or systemic inflammatory disease
  • Prior lumbar spine surgery
  • Heat or cold therapy to the lumbar region within the past 6 weeks
  • Dermatologic lesions, open wounds, or skin conditions over the lumbar area
  • Contraindications to heat (e.g., impaired sensation/neuropathy over the area, severe circulatory disorders)
  • Implanted electronic devices (e.g., pacemaker)
  • Inability to comply with the study schedule or procedures

主要结局

Change in Lumbar Erector Spinae Stiffness (MyotonPro, N/m) From Baseline to Immediate Post-Intervention

时间窗: Baseline and immediately post-session (~20-30 minutes)

Myotonometric stiffness (N/m) is captured over lumbar erector spinae (L3-L4 level, \~2-3 cm lateral). Three taps per point; averaged. Endpoint is change score (Post - Baseline); negative values indicate reduced stiffness.
